Patrick -> RE: Rafael Romero 1A Blanca on Ebay, and some other flamenco stuff (Mar. 13 2007 20:11:29)

A year or so ago I picked up a Rafael Romero model 120 negra. I didn't really need another guitar, but I couldn't pass up the price and I could use it as a beater. Boy was I pleasantly surprised. The model 120 is no longer available and was built by Rafael's assistants and is just a hair rough in a couple of places. Now granted, the tone isn't world class, but I can easily say it’s in the league of a bunch of $3,000 guitars I have played, and I have less than a grand into it.

It’s my understanding the 1A is primarily built by Rafael. I haven’t played a 1A, but if its like his low end 120 like I have it should be outstanding. I think JB is selling himself a bit short. To bring a 1A into the US with shipping and duty it would be closer to $3,000. Ole Flamenco has it listed for something like $2,500 plus shipping and duty.

Rafael is very good flamenco player and knows what they are supposed to sound like.
